I would agree, Simon. The cross over of fans and/or drivers between the events would be minimal. The only dirt late model driver I know of that is passing on the St. Louis event to come to Du Quoin is Brian Shirley and to my knowledge there are no midget regulars who are passing on Du Quoin to race at St. Louis. We've attended every midget show but one that has ever been held in the SIC dating all the way back to when they ran a 2 night POWRi show during the Du Quoin State Fair on the Friday and Saturday nights of Labor Day Weekend. The crowd last year (2016) was at least as large as the year before (2015) when there was no St. Louis race.

It would certainly be interesting to know why they'd opt for Friday night over Saturday in 2018.
